Abstract

5,5′-Diethoxy-3,3′-methanediyl- bis-indole 1 was synthesized by novel protocol and its solid state structure was analyzed using X-ray diffraction and 13C CP/MAS NMR methods. Double resonances were observed in the spectrum of 1, and different structure of both indole systems in one molecule (shown by X-ray studies) is responsible for this spectral pattern. In the crystal only one intermolecular hydrogen bond (N1–H1⋯O11′) was revealed, which is uncommon among bis-indole derivatives.
